Description

Active ingredient: Iodised Peanut Oil containing 26% Organically bound iodine

Horizon Iodine Injection provides organically bound iodine in a sterile, sustained release (depot) formulation

It consists of peanut oil and is desinged for intramuscular injection. At temperatures below 5 Celcius it becomes viscous and solidifies. It is best that the oil is not frozen, but if this occurs it can be restored by warming to room temerature without loss of efficacy

INDICATIONS For treatment and prevention of primary and secondary iodine deficiency in sheep and cattle of all ages, Normally, one injection of iodised oil will supply sufficient iodine for a period of a year.

A. Treatment of Iodine Deficiency: Animals with goitre, and those suspected of having subclinical iodine deficiency, should be treated with a single dose at a rate of 3mL in claves, and 1.5mL in lambs.  It is also recommended that the ewes be treated at a dose rate of 1.5mL/50kg and cows be treated at a dose rate of 1mL/100kg when goitre is detected in lambs and calves

B. Prevention of primary iodine deficiency:  Lambs: Treat at weaning,  Ewes: Treat one month before mating, or not less than two months before lambing,  Rams: Treat one month before mating,  Calves: Treat at weaning,  Cattle: Treat one month before mating, or not less than two months before calving

C. Prevention of induced iodine deficiency:  ALL STOCK: Treat at least two months prior to the feeding of Brassica or other goitrogenic crops. Repeat treatment annually to avoid subclinical iodine deficiency.  Dairy cattle may require more frequent treatment to maintain adequate iodine levels

Directions for use.

It is recommended that veterinary advice is sought before using this product when iodine supplementation has not been previously used previously.  For intramuscular injection in the anterior half of the neck

Sheep & Lambs  1.5mL

Cattle 1mL/100kg body weight

Horizon Iodine Injection can be injected through a 16 gauge needle, and is suitable for administration by using a draw-off tube and injector. Under cold ambient conditions, the bottle may be warmed to 20-25 Celcius to improve flow through the injector and needle.

Precaution When administering this product at the same time as other iodine-containing products/supplements use with caution

Storage Store below 25 Clecius. Do not freeze. Protect from light. Always store in original container with draw-off cord removed. Once opened must be used in 3 months

WITHHOLDING PERIOD: NIL Milk and Meat
